			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ong><u>What is the topic about?</u></strong> </p>
<p>This topic is designed to explain to you the great learning tool that the Internet can be and the important role it now plays in the world by allowing us like sharing information, knowledge and ideas. </p>
<p>In this unit we will also be discussing the dangers of the Internet and the precautions we can take to help protect us again some of the hazards the Internet can present.</p>
<p><strong><u>Lesson1: Introduction</u></strong> </p>
<p>This is the first lesson on the topic of searching the web. We will be looking at the differences between fact and opinion and how to tell if a websites content is reliable, accurate, bias or valid by checking various points such as the websites address and the date it was last updated.</p>
